Mcdonalds Millpond Dam

Mcdonalds Millpond Dam is an earth dam located in Ben Hill County, Georgia. It carries a Low hazard potential classification.

About Mcdonalds Millpond Dam

The primary purpose of Mcdonalds Millpond Dam is recreation. The dam creates a reservoir used for recreational activities such as fishing, boating, and swimming. The dam is owned by Mcdonald, Paul A. (private). It impounds the Dicksons Mill Creek.

The dam stands 11 feet tall and stretches 445 feet across, creates a reservoir covering 40 acres, and has a maximum storage capacity of 295 acre-feet.

This dam has a low hazard potential classification, meaning that failure would cause minimal damage, limited primarily to the dam owner's property, with no expected loss of life. The most recent inspection on record was 10/18/2016.
